Design and architect features in GPU compute and graphics stimulus development frameworks for functional and performance verification.
Develop core infrastructure and tools such as debuggers and disassemblers to support GPU modeling, analysis, and debugging across the chip lifecycle.
Collaborate with GPU architects and hardware/software teams to enhance GPU software ecosystem and speed up development workflows for chip modelers and designers.
Bachelor's or Master's degree in Computer Science, Computer Engineering, or equivalent experience.
3+ years of experience primarily working on C++ based projects with strong C++ programming skills.
Knowledge of object-oriented design patterns and strong understanding of system software and operating systems.
Experience with massively parallel algorithm design; experience with chip or system simulation is a significant plus.
Experienced in designing and developing complex parallel computation frameworks and GPU development tools.
Proficient in working closely with hardware and software teams to accelerate GPU software ecosystem development.
Has exposure to graphics and CUDA APIs, and understands GPU architecture and performance modeling challenges.
